White Paper Selecting fluids for hydraulic pumps - Eaton
Hydraulic fluid is one of the most important components of a hydraulic system. It performs multiple functions, such as power transmission, lubrication, heat transfer, and conveyance of sludge, wear debris, and contamination. With the important roles played by fluids, proper fluid selection is critical in maximizing performance

CHAPTER 5: Pneumatic and hydraulic systems | Hydraulics ...
Hydraulic systems. A hydraulic system circulates the same fluid repeatedly from a fixed reservoir that is part of the prime mover. The fluid is an almost non-compressible liquid, so the actuators it drives can be controlled to very accurate positions, speeds, or forces.

Practical Hydraulic Systems | ScienceDirect
The working fluid is the single most important component of any hydraulic system. It serves as a lubricant, heat transfer medium, and most important of all, a means of energy transfer. Fluid characteristics play a critical part in determining the performance and life of the equipment.

The Seven Most Common Hydraulic Equipment Mistakes
The oil is the most important component of any hydraulic system. Not only is hydraulic oil a lubricant, it is also the means by which power is transferred throughout the hydraulic system. It’s this dual role which makes viscosity the most important property of the oil, because it affects both machine performance and service life.
